3. The point P(2,-1) lies on the curve y=1/(1-x). (a) If Q is the point (x,1/(1-x)) use your calculator to find the slope of the secant line PQ (correct to six decimal places) for the following values of x: (b) Using the results of part (a), guess the value of the slope of the tangent line to the curve at P(2,-1). (c) Using the slope from part (b), find an equation of the tangent line to the curve at P(2,-1) Calculus: Early Transcendentals Chapter 2: Limits and Derivatives Section 2.1: The Tangent and Velocity Problems Problem 3 Video 346 of Hourly Uploads - 9/15/2023 - 276 Subscribers - 74,953 Views
